Transaction 6bbac840ce94f90cc2138db892e34a84ac1000d9177ac3dd209014486f5dbadf
1 Input
1 Output
-
6bbac840ce94f90cc2138db892e34a84ac1000d9177ac3dd209014486f5dbadf:0
- value
- 367213
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bcea6e701b38581bcd4640f7c9ba6090c8b1522f OP_EQUAL
- address
- 3JuuoBoDyD97pH6SuEPLtV5EjbUq3AYDF6